Team workshops are interactive sessions designed to enhance collaboration, improve skills, and align goals within a group. These workshops are crucial for fostering a positive team environment and can be tailored to meet the specific needs of any organization or group. Below are descriptions of various types of team workshops along with some examples:

1. Team Building Workshops
These workshops focus on strengthening the bonds among team members, enhancing communication, and building trust. Activities are designed to break down barriers in the workplace and promote a more cohesive unit.
  • Example: A problem-solving workshop where teams navigate through a series of physical and mental challenges, encouraging members to rely on each other’s strengths and work collaboratively.

2. Leadership Development Workshops
These sessions are aimed at developing leadership skills within team members, helping them to take initiative, make decisions, and inspire others effectively.
  • Example: Role-playing scenarios where team members take turns leading a group through various tasks, receiving feedback on their leadership style and effectiveness from both peers and facilitators.

3. Communication Workshops
Focused on enhancing interpersonal communication skills within the team, these workshops address issues such as conflict resolution, effective listening, and clear messaging.
  • Example: Activities that require team members to communicate complex ideas using non-verbal methods, fostering clarity in communication and highlighting the importance of body language and tone.

4. Strategic Planning Workshops
These workshops help teams to align on goals, set objectives, and develop actionable plans to achieve them. They are particularly useful for project kick-offs or annual planning.
  • Example: Facilitated sessions where teams map out their project timeline, identify key milestones, assign responsibilities, and anticipate potential challenges.

5. Creative Thinking and Innovation Workshops
Designed to unlock the creative potential of team members, these workshops encourage thinking outside the box and foster an innovative mindset.
  • Example: Using techniques like brainstorming, mind mapping, or the SCAMPER method to generate new ideas for products, services, or internal processes.

6. Cultural Competence Workshops
These sessions aim to enhance understanding and appreciation of diverse backgrounds and perspectives within the team, crucial for global and culturally diverse teams.
  • Example: Interactive discussions and role-plays that explore different cultural norms and how they influence workplace interactions and expectations.

7. Customer Service Excellence Workshops
Focused on teams that interact with customers, these workshops aim to improve customer engagement, satisfaction, and loyalty.
  • Example: Scenario-based training that involves handling difficult customer interactions, understanding customer needs, and improving service delivery.

Each of these workshops can be adapted to virtual, in-person, or hybrid formats depending on the team's location and availability. They are often facilitated by experts who can provide a structured environment conducive to learning and growth.
